Smoke-Free Campus

Vanderbilt University is a smoke-free campus and all students are subject to the Smoking, Tobacco and e-Cigarettes Policy. Smoking and the use of electronic cigarettes, vaporizers, etc., are prohibited on all Vanderbilt-owned and lease property, including University residence halls and Greek chapter houses.

Locations of designated smoking areas for students, faculty, staff and campus visitors may be found on the “Smoking Locations” online map available on the Facilities webpage. Designated smoking areas are marked by cigarette disposal urns.

Greek organizations may elect to designate outdoor smoking areas on their house grounds.

Vanderbilt University is committed to providing a healthy, comfortable, and productive environment and offers several resources for smoking cessation.
